{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":796360361,"defaultBranch":"main","name":"pinecil2mqtt","ownerLogin":"excieve","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-05-05T17:57:09.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/1077193?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1714931846.0","currentOid":""},"activityList":{"items":[{"before":"fc8bfa0afbb8359872ee02542c480b62b85f8630","after":"8616d22440e002c550ff1a41ffa1448f69b82dc1","ref":"refs/heads/main","pushedAt":"2024-05-08T18:21: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(readme): adds container docs","shortMessageHtmlLink":"chore(readme): adds container docs"}},{"before":"d5c6d09b4f710defe17e905da79d75363675aaae","after":"fc8bfa0afbb8359872ee02542c480b62b85f8630","ref":"refs/heads/main","pushedAt":"2024-05-08T17:57: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"fix(actions): remove aarch64/arm64 for now as linking fails in Alpine","shortMessageHtmlLink":"fix(actions): remove aarch64/arm64 for now as linking fails in Alpine"}},{"before":"fb9e21cd8358884e022a7b483f320b0c1192135f","after":"d5c6d09b4f710defe17e905da79d75363675aaae","ref":"refs/heads/main","pushedAt":"2024-05-08T17:14: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"fix(actions): typo fix in CD action","shortMessageHtmlLink":"fix(actions): typo fix in CD action"}},{"before":"eba698900274e643e09e10ab23b0c01ae45449cc","after":"fb9e21cd8358884e022a7b483f320b0c1192135f","ref":"refs/heads/main","pushedAt":"2024-05-08T17:12: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(actions): a CD pipeline for container images","shortMessageHtmlLink":"feat(actions): a CD pipeline for container images"}},{"before":"932f471f55e6ebf161ce5682c0f4cc12a6f7c229","after":"eba698900274e643e09e10ab23b0c01ae45449cc","ref":"refs/heads/main","pushedAt":"2024-05-07T18:06:57.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(build): adds Dockerfile","shortMessageHtmlLink":"feat(build): adds Dockerfile"}},{"before":"e6ce294776afa3f7171a69ec5fa4600d9b1da7c6","after":"932f471f55e6ebf161ce5682c0f4cc12a6f7c229","ref":"refs/heads/main","pushedAt":"2024-05-06T23:07: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(readme): adds example Grafana dashboard screenshot","shortMessageHtmlLink":"chore(readme): adds example Grafana dashboard screenshot"}},{"before":"164207af824f5f3a82ff4b8f27212f94d1231a06","after":"e6ce294776afa3f7171a69ec5fa4600d9b1da7c6","ref":"refs/heads/main","pushedAt":"2024-05-06T22:09: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(cargo): reduced tokio feature set a bit","shortMessageHtmlLink":"chore(cargo): reduced tokio feature set a bit"}},{"before":"a3fc6a8b22fc786df0240ee3fcc2f1bd9a2bb7b8","after":"164207af824f5f3a82ff4b8f27212f94d1231a06","ref":"refs/heads/main","pushedAt":"2024-05-06T21:52: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(readme): adds new configuration docs","shortMessageHtmlLink":"chore(readme): adds new configuration docs"}},{"before":"89ac00f5ded57412fb8e6ef93a5b79e38a19c78d","after":"a3fc6a8b22fc786df0240ee3fcc2f1bd9a2bb7b8","ref":"refs/heads/main","pushedAt":"2024-05-06T21:45:18.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(config): optional file and env vars as sources, use config crate","shortMessageHtmlLink":"feat(config): optional file and env vars as sources, use config crate"}},{"before":"ea001d37b8fcb0e82048683e776223c9764bc9dd","after":"89ac00f5ded57412fb8e6ef93a5b79e38a19c78d","ref":"refs/heads/main","pushedAt":"2024-05-06T20:03:24.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(main): basic CLI with clap","shortMessageHtmlLink":"feat(main): basic CLI with clap"}},{"before":"e86c9bd504bd0b7a723b3739385e0dc8535c4d36","after":"ea001d37b8fcb0e82048683e776223c9764bc9dd","ref":"refs/heads/main","pushedAt":"2024-05-06T18:28: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"fix(pinecil): spawn bulk data polling in a task to avoid BLE DeviceConnected event blocking","shortMessageHtmlLink":"fix(pinecil): spawn bulk data polling in a task to avoid BLE DeviceCo…"}},{"before":"ef276e9fa693cc0af92ccdc606a232e4493e4d14","after":"e86c9bd504bd0b7a723b3739385e0dc8535c4d36","ref":"refs/heads/main","pushedAt":"2024-05-06T17:44: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"refactor(pinecil): repace hardcoded service/char strings with const UUIDs","shortMessageHtmlLink":"refactor(pinecil): repace hardcoded service/char strings with const U…"}},{"before":"44ed6afc154b3006665bb0ef3f3464f6fc2882f9","after":"ef276e9fa693cc0af92ccdc606a232e4493e4d14","ref":"refs/heads/main","pushedAt":"2024-05-06T17:27: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"fix(pinecil): discover Pinecil by initial service instead of name","shortMessageHtmlLink":"fix(pinecil): discover Pinecil by initial service instead of name"}},{"before":"2f76409375ea617d670412be5e9a49a375ff83eb","after":"44ed6afc154b3006665bb0ef3f3464f6fc2882f9","ref":"refs/heads/main","pushedAt":"2024-05-06T13:46: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(readme): document MQTT data structure, pre-requisites, alternatives","shortMessageHtmlLink":"chore(readme): document MQTT data structure, pre-requisites, alternat…"}},{"before":"2431443f293829baaff31aff7f0471e42875c5a1","after":"2f76409375ea617d670412be5e9a49a375ff83eb","ref":"refs/heads/main","pushedAt":"2024-05-06T13:12:33.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(transformer): adds bulk data transformer with labels and timestamp","shortMessageHtmlLink":"feat(transformer): adds bulk data transformer with labels and timestamp"}},{"before":"0a7ab94a3771f6e32781394445e5402e20ea193b","after":"2431443f293829baaff31aff7f0471e42875c5a1","ref":"refs/heads/main","pushedAt":"2024-05-06T10:45: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(pinecil): pass device ID as an MQTT topic part","shortMessageHtmlLink":"feat(pinecil): pass device ID as an MQTT topic part"}},{"before":"e39e1578e9e6b1328bf7d6d4f2568530a3670b30","after":"0a7ab94a3771f6e32781394445e5402e20ea193b","ref":"refs/heads/main","pushedAt":"2024-05-06T10:23: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"feat(pinecil): query device ID characteristic","shortMessageHtmlLink":"feat(pinecil): query device ID characteristic"}},{"before":"c5ebbbf2aa8a0d877561a7d80a5b4000dca40b8f","after":"e39e1578e9e6b1328bf7d6d4f2568530a3670b30","ref":"refs/heads/main","pushedAt":"2024-05-05T20:28: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"fix(pinecil): reconnect on DeviceUpdated BLE event to handle already discovered device coming back","shortMessageHtmlLink":"fix(pinecil): reconnect on DeviceUpdated BLE event to handle already …"}},{"before":"23a82e11fc60e3a04fdfd28b7031fa5decbfc550","after":"c5ebbbf2aa8a0d877561a7d80a5b4000dca40b8f","ref":"refs/heads/main","pushedAt":"2024-05-05T18:01:24.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(license): adds Apache License 2.0","shortMessageHtmlLink":"chore(license): adds Apache License 2.0"}},{"before":null,"after":"23a82e11fc60e3a04fdfd28b7031fa5decbfc550","ref":"refs/heads/main","pushedAt":"2024-05-05T17:57:26.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"excieve","name":"Artem Hluvchynskyi","path":"/excieve","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1077193?s=80&v=4"},"commit":{"message":"chore(readme): clarify","shortMessageHtmlLink":"chore(readme): clarify"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EROzP4gA","startCursor":null,"endCursor":null}},"title":"Activity · excieve/pinecil2mqtt"}